Faculty Contacts Program for Criminology & Criminal Justice MajorsThe Criminology & Criminal Justice Department is initiating a new program that will allow students to interact more closely with members of the faculty. All majors have been assigned to a faculty member in their discipline. The faculty contact can talk about the major as a field of study, post-graduation possibilities in the field, applying to graduate or professional schools, and they can answer questions the student might have about their particular field of study. However, the faculty contact does not replace your academic advisor. For information about programs of study and requirements for graduation, students should still contact the College of Arts and Sciences Advising Office. For convenience, students in each major have been assigned a faculty advisor by last name. Simply find where your name fits in the left hand column, and you will see your faculty advisor in corresponding right hand column. Just call or visit your faculty member during office hours.
